How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 70054?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 70054 Studio Apartments | $1,185 | $716 | $1,792 |
| 70054 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,549 | $750 | $4,294 |
| 70054 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,884 | $872 | $7,289 |
| 70054 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,852 | $962 | $6,224 |
| 70054 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,542 | $1,085 | $2,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 70054 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 70054?
There are currently 387 Studio Apartments in 70054 with rent ranges from $716 to $1,792 with an average price of $1,185.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 70054 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 70054 ranges from $750 to $4,294 with an average monthly rent of $1,549.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 70054 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 70054 range from $872 to $7,289.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,884.
How expensive are 70054 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 42 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 70054 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$962 to $6,224 - averaging $1,852 for the location.
